There will be a chance to join East Riding Libraries this February Half-Term (20-24 February) for an animal -themed storytime, inspired by the Wildlife Photographer of the Year Exhibition at Beverley Art Gallery, which runs from 11 February to 22 April.

The libraries team have selected some fun stories including ‘One to Ten, Animal Mayhem’ by Thomas Flintham, ideally suited to pre-schoolers; and David Walliams’s ‘First Hippo on the Moon’ which is fun for all the family.

Schools across the East Riding were represented at a ceremony which celebrated their success in supporting cycling, walking and other forms of sustainable travel.

The schools were presented with certificates and plaques in recognition of their work towards the Modeshift STARS national schools awards scheme.
